Will of Emmanuel Foote In re I, Emmanuel Foote, resident of Harbor Breton, in the District of Fortune Bay, Newfoundland, do hereby make my last will and testament: I give and bequeath to my wife Elizabeth Foote all my lands house, furniture, situated at Harbor Breton for her use during her life-time. Whatever remains of my property at the time of my wife’s Elizabeth Foote’s death is to be sold and the proceeds is to be equally divided into four parts and given to my three children- to each one part- Maria Jane Ross, Bertha Tryphena Mavin, Emily Spenser, and one part to my grandson Isaac Foote. In witness hereto, I place my mark this 7th day of ____ Emmanuel his X mark Foote. Emmanuel Foote made his mark in our presence and we in his presence and the presence of each other signed out names this 7th day of Feb. 1913 (Listed in the margin next to this will the following)
